GGDROP is a CS2 case-opening platform founded in 2018. It offers a broad range of cases varying in rarity and price, along with additional features like Case Battles, Contracts, and Upgraders. The Contract system allows users to exchange 3–10 skins for a random one, while the Upgrader lets players enhance their items using existing skins or balance.
The site hosts regular events and includes a Bonus Wheel that can be spun every 72 hours. Promo codes can be used for deposit bonuses. The provably fair system ensures transparency and fairness in all outcomes.
GGDROP supports multiple deposit methods, including bank cards, e-wallets, and cryptocurrency. Although primarily targeting Russian-speaking users, the platform is also available internationally.

GGDROP has been operating since 2018 and functions under a Curaçao license, offering a basic level of regulatory oversight. The platform uses Provably Fair technology to ensure fair results, and its game mechanics have been audited by iTech Labs. Despite its popularity, there are some user complaints online regarding delays in large withdrawals and disputes over bonus policies. Nonetheless, overall trust in the site remains high due to its transparency and stable daily operations.

GGDROP supports a wide variety of deposit and withdrawal methods: cryptocurrencies (BTC, USDT), bank cards, CS2 skins, and e-wallets. Skin withdrawals are instant up to $1,000, while crypto transactions are processed within 5–60 minutes. Fees are moderate: 3% for crypto, 5% for skins.
